Transaction 40161701066e37341812486712205ccbf79eb77f50d55f0e4e3410b96e89c5bd

5 Input
2 Outputs
  • 40161701066e37341812486712205ccbf79eb77f50d55f0e4e3410b96e89c5bd:0
  • value  1034000000
    address  1KFZYTN2uWfSissGLSvPYmcZGJPw7yzCAu
  • 40161701066e37341812486712205ccbf79eb77f50d55f0e4e3410b96e89c5bd:1
  • value  1481689909
    address  17jyNSoUpVJH2CYVm2wZYbamWYA9AqQKke